Highlights
Are people in Goshen older or younger than people in Plainwell?
- The Median Age in Goshen is 2.1 years younger than in Plainwell.

Are housing costs cheaper in Goshen or Plainwell?
- Goshen housing costs are 29.1% more expensive than Plainwell hous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Goshen or Plainwell?
- The average commute for residents of Goshen is 6.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Plainwell.

Things to do in Plainwell?
Living in Plainwell, MI is a great experience. The small town offers a close-knit community and a variety of activities for young and old alike. The public schools are top notch, and the area has many parks, trails, and other outdoor recreational areas. Residents enjoy a variety of dining options from family-run restaurants to fast food establishments. The downtown area is bustling with shops, eateries, and businesses that cater to all tastes and interests. Residents also have access to nearby larger cities such as Kalamazoo and Grand Rapids for additional entertainment offerings. Overall it's an enjoyable place to live!
